What is the meaning of Chakras?
"Chakra" is a Sanskrit word meaning wheel.
Chakras are energy centers, cogs in the wheel, located in the body and corresponding in some ways to crossroads or traffic circles.
In traditional Indian medicine, they are represented by different colors and functions.
The seven main Chakras are responsible for conveying vital energy:
1 - The Root Chakra between the perineum and coccyx (red)
2 - The Sacral Chakra below the navel (orange)
3 - Solar plexus chakra (yellow and red)
4 - Heart Chakra in the middle of the chest (green and pink)
5 - Laryngeal Chakra at throat level (blue)
6 - Third Eye Chakra between the eyebrows (indigo)
7 - Coronal Chakra at the top of the head (violet and white)
In traditional Indian medicine, when one of our chakras is disturbed, our entire physical and mental balance is upset.
